Self-taught visual artist, Arnaud invites you to daydream and return to childhood with his creations of antique objects assembled by arc welding, riveting and others. ..
It was in 2017 that his late journey began at the age of 46, a native of Beauvais and expatriate in the Montpellier region in As an adolescent, composer and pianist above all, desire and curiosity led him to the plastic arts after being fascinated by the work of certain sculptors using recycled objects like the Australian artist James Corbett who remains one of his references, self-taught having not followed any training in this field, he will become more experienced over the months, first of all by becoming familiar with the assembly technique by simple rivet and screw and over time by the arc welding technique which allows him to go further in his creative ideas and desires.
< p>His work is detailed and studied in advance by initially researching pieces mostly from second-hand salvage, his world revolves around vehicles, characters and animals while bringing a touch of humor and playfulness.
His imagination plunges us with poetry into an enchanting world punctuated with nods to the memory of toys from our childhood.
Continuing his quest Arnaud invests himself in his creations while pushing the details of his achievements into his ideal vision.
